Pleasant Valley Manor will be privatizing its operations. In a press release from Monroe County, the manor’s regulatory and fiscal challenges in the post-COVID pandemic healthcare environment were cited as the reason for the move. Monroe County Commissioner and president of the PVM board Sharon Laverdure said that privatizing will help PVM by allowing the parent company to use its resources to help fund and maintain the facility. According to Lutton, the Pleasant Valley Manor board hired a company to vet companies who were interested in taking over the manor, and Outcome Health was chosen to partner with the manor.
